Gochujang Glazed Cauliflower
Gochujang Glazed Cauliflower is a vibrant and flavorful vegetarian dish that brings the essence of Korean BBQ to your table. The spicy-sweet glaze perfectly caramelizes the cauliflower, creating a delightful balance of heat and umami.

30 minutes
Difficulty: Easy
Korean
180 kcal
Ingredients
- Cauliflower - 1 medium head (about 600g)
- Gochujang (Korean red chili paste) - 2 tablespoons
- Soy sauce - 1 tablespoon
- Maple syrup - 1 tablespoon
- Sesame oil - 1 tablespoon
- Garlic - 2 cloves, minced
- Ginger - 1 teaspoon, minced
- Vegetable oil - 1 tablespoon
- Sesame seeds - 1 tablespoon, for garnish
- Green onion - 1, chopped, for garnish
Steps
- Preheat your oven to 200°C (400°F).
- Wash and cut the cauliflower into bite-sized florets.
- In a large bowl, combine gochujang, soy sauce, maple syrup, sesame oil, minced garlic, and minced ginger to create the glaze.
- Add the cauliflower florets to the bowl and toss until they are evenly coated in the glaze.
- Spread the glazed cauliflower onto a baking sheet lined with parchment paper in a single layer.
- Drizzle vegetable oil over the cauliflower and toss lightly to ensure even cooking.
- Roast in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until the cauliflower is tender and caramelized, stirring halfway through.
- Remove from the oven and let cool slightly before serving.
- Garnish with sesame seeds and chopped green onion before serving.
